.....if the ship docks on the 17th...how long until the cars are on a truck on the way home?
i think there are way too many factors (first or last off ship, how many cars on the ship, full truck going toward your dealership, etc) in the process to make any definite guesses. here is an interesting write up of the VPC from a couple of years ago:

http://www.autospies.com/news/Did-yo...-factory-1348/

it says the VPC can process about 400 cars per day. if there are 1870 cars on the ship then it will take at least 4-5 days to get through them all. if you're in the first group then you're golden; if not, well that would really suck. priority one cars (non-ED sold cars) are apparently done first so most of us tracking here should be in that situation. it would be interesting to know if they load the ship in such a way that the P1 cars get unloaded first - my guess would be that they get sorted out between unloading and the VPC.

my dealership has said they usually run 5-7 days after the ship docks before delivery to them. i remember one in a recent thread that was delivered to seattle on the third day after the ship docked/unloaded though. considering the drive from oxnard to seattle is quite a bit of that time, i found that particularly impressive and hopeful - especially, since i'm about 5 hours closer to oxnard.
